Two of a Kind
Marcel runs into another member of the old French resistance and she wants his help in supplying guidance for her son whom she thinks may be involved in the theft of a stamp. After Marcel meets him, he thinks he may be his son, but this boy needs an education on being a ""Rouge.""

Read MoreThe Diamond-Studded Pie
Tony poses as a ""Great White Hunter,"" where the plan is to take an American businessman on the hunt of his life. Only wild animals aren't the intended game, it's some well-placed diamonds.
